Pack falls in battle of the ranked
PUEBLO,Colo. -(GoThunderWolves.com-April, 13,2012)- Playing in their final home stand before heading out to the RMAC Tournament, the CSU-Pueblo Men's Tennis team suffered two losses at the hands of the Nationally ranked (#35) and RMAC favorite Nebraska-Kearney and Montana State-Billings.
In the first battle of the day, CSU-Pueblo faced #4 Regionally ranked MSU-Billings and fell two-games to seven. The ThundeWolves' two victories came in singles action. Bruno Hurtado (Jr., Mexico City, Mexcio) locked down one of the Packs wins at number-1 singles, winning 6-1, 6-2. Win number two came from Saul Shrom (So., Winnipeg, Manitoba, Canada) at the number-3 singles spot when he won 6-3, 6-2.
Next up for the ThunderWolves was RMAC foe and powerhouse Nebraska-Kearney. Even though the Pack took another loss, 3-games to six, there was plenty of excitement along the way.
Trying to set the tone earlier for the Pack was their number-one doubles team of Alex Lesiuk(Fr., Winnipeg, Canada) and Shrom. Facing the Lopers #1 regionally ranked doubles team of Raymond/Nadella, the Canadian duo worked their magic and pulled off the upset 8-6, for their sixth win of the season.
Also flexing their muscle at number-three doubles were Tom Chavez (Jr., Pueblo, Colo.) and Hurtado. Their win, 8-6, took the Pack into the lead going into the singles.
Staying hot, Shrom posted the Pack's only other win, again at number-three singles, 6-1, 6-4.
The ThunderWolves start RMAC Tournament action Friday, April 20, 2012 in Denver, Colo.
